    Spring Creek Bluegrass Band

    Spring Creek is quickly gaining a reputation as the hottest young band in the Rocky Mountains. The quartet play a mix of bluegrass standards and compelling originals, and all four musicians are also accomplished vocalists. Spring Creek is built on the fundamentals of bluegrass, yet they create their own classic contemporary style. The young band, have studied and performed together for several years, creating a tight, polished sound. Judges at two recent band competitions agree that Spring Creek have what it takes to deliver the high, lonesome sounds in the Appalachian tradition. The band won the Telluride Bluegrass Festival band contest back in June, and won their second Planet Bluegrass title on July 29th at the 35th annual Rocky Mountain Festival held in Lyons.
